Exploring the Maximum Age Difference in Romantic Relationships.
Gertrude Grubb Janeway’s marriage to John Janeway may be one of the largest recorded age gaps between couples. At the time of their marriage, Gertrude was only 18 years old, while John was a Civil War veteran and 81 years old. The difference in age between them was a staggering 63 years, making it a widely talked-about union. Gertrude was the last Union widow of a Civil War veteran and lived to the age of 93, having been married to John for over 75 years. While their marriage was unconventional and raised eyebrows in their community, it was a testament to their love and commitment to each other, regardless of their significant age difference.
Is there such a thing as an unacceptable age difference in relationships?
The ‘rule of 7’ is a dating guideline that has been around for quite some time. It suggests that for a relationship to be considered socially acceptable, the younger person involved should be at least half the age of the older person, plus seven years. For instance, if someone is 40 years old, the youngest person they can date without raising eyebrows is 27. This rule has been widely used to determine whether a relationship is appropriate or not.
The origin story of the ‘rule of 7’ is not very clear, but it has been in use for a long time. This guideline is meant to ensure there is a reasonable age gap between the partners and to prevent relationships that might be deemed unethical or inappropriate. While the rule is not set in stone, it is often used to determine the minimum and maximum age difference that is socially acceptable in a relationship.

Exploring the Dangers of Relationships with Significant Age Differences
Predatory age gap relationships are those where an older person manipulates and takes advantage of a younger person who is often naive and inexperienced. In such relationships, the older person holds all the power and the younger person is at a disadvantage. These kinds of relationships require grooming, which is the process of gradually gaining the younger person’s trust and confidence, so that the older person can exploit them emotionally, financially or sexually.
Predatory age gap relationships are often characterized by a significant power imbalance, where the older person uses their age, status, and experience to control the younger person. The younger person may feel trapped, powerless, and unable to leave the relationship even if they want to. This is because the older person may have made them feel dependent on them, or may have threatened them in some way.
It’s important to recognize that predatory age gap relationships are not healthy or consensual. They are abusive and exploitative, and can cause serious harm to the younger person involved. Navigating Age Differences in Relationships: What’s Considered Acceptable?
When it comes to age gaps in relationships, many people wonder what is considered acceptable. According to research, an age gap of 1 to 3 years is commonly viewed as ideal in many cultures. However, some studies suggest that even a relationship with an age gap of less than 10 years can result in higher levels of satisfaction for both partners. This may be due to the fact that individuals who are close in age tend to have more in common in terms of life experiences, cultural references, and overall life stage.
Of course, what is considered an acceptable age gap can vary greatly depending on personal and cultural factors. Some individuals may be comfortable with a larger age gap, while others may feel that even a few years can make a significant difference in a relationship.
